Designed for the automotive, paint and plastic industries for quality control of colour, appearance and physical properties, BYK’s new color2view is a benchtop spectrophotometer that combines several different measurement methods.
The color2view uses a circumferential illumination at 45-degree and zero-degree viewing to measure colour as you see it. And this circumferential illumination from 10 directions safeguards repeatable measurement results on textured surfaces. Simultaneously with colour, 20-degree and 60-degree gloss are measured to clearly differentiate medium and high gloss samples.
This unit also features an integrated fluorimeter to predict lightfastness by quantifying fluorescence. This combination of spectrophotometer and fluorimeter lends new perspectives for controlling colour quality and long-term colour stability. And there is a Jetness Mode designed to measure deep and deepest black with high accuracy.
The colour touchscreen is icon-based and as intuitive as operating a smart-phone. And this lightweight instrument is easily rotated to adapt the orientation to one’s personal needs or sample size and shape.

Paul N. Gardner USA, global distributors, producers, and designers of quality physical and inspection instruments for the paint, coatings, and related industries, has introduced a new offering: The compact, portable Sling Psychrometer.
As an easy way to measure relative humidity levels quickly, this uniquely compact Bacharach Sling Psychrometer accurately determines per cent relative humidity without the necessity of consulting complex tables. There is no need to wet the wick each time a reading is taken, and it contains a slide rule calculator which correlates wet and dry bulb thermometer indications for direct reading of relative humidity. When not in use, the thermometer case telescopes into the handle for protection.
The Sling Psychrometer consists of two thermometers that are turned by vigorously swinging the handle and exposing the thermometers to rapid air movement. These two thermometers are called dry bulb and wet bulb. The bulb of one thermometer is placed in direct contact with the room air to measure dry-bulb air temperature. The bulb of the other thermometer is covered with a silk or muslin sleeve that is kept moist to record the wet bulb temperature. Evaporation cools the wet bulb more than the dry bulb, and the humidity is obtained as a function of change in temperature. The atmospheric humidity is determined by calculations, steam tables, or using a psychrometric chart. Gardco.com
